The Emergence of India’s Pace Attack

India’s rapid bowling revolution marks a paradigm shift in the nation’s cricketing landscape, moving away from historical reliance on spin bowling. Over the last ten years, Indian pace bowlers have demonstrated impressive consistency and proficiency across all formats, establishing themselves as match-winners on world cricket stages. Players like Jasprit Bumrah, Mohammed Shami, and Ishant Sharma have exhibited technical excellence and mental fortitude, generating breakthrough performances in crucial Test matches against established powerhouses. This evolution demonstrates strategic investments in talent development and contemporary coaching approaches.

The emergence of a strong fast bowling unit has fundamentally altered India’s Test cricket strategy, allowing them to compete effectively in different playing conditions worldwide. Young talents like Siraj and Prasidh Krishna introduce new vitality and aggression to the pace attack, supporting experienced campaigners. This multi-tier strategy guarantees continued success and continuity in performance. The combined achievements of these bowlers has made a substantial contribution to India’s improved Test rankings and their competitive advantage in international competitions, marking a transformative period in Indian cricket history.

Bumrah’s Influence

Jasprit Bumrah stands as India’s leading pace bowler, transforming fast bowling with his unconventional technique and exceptional accuracy. His skill in executing yorkers with regularity and handle death bowling has rendered him essential across every format. In Test cricket, Bumrah’s efforts have been pivotal in achieving significant triumphs against top-ranked teams. His unique biomechanics and intelligent bowling strategies have established his reputation as one of cricket’s most complete bowlers. Bumrah’s role in the squad substantially enhances India’s bowling unit, offering both seasoned expertise and fresh ideas.

Beyond sheer pace, Bumrah’s cricketing acumen sets him apart from contemporaries. He displays remarkable adaptability, changing his tactics based on game conditions and rival shortcomings. His reliability under pressure, especially on batting-friendly surfaces, highlights his technical mastery. Bumrah’s coaching of emerging talent has cultivated a culture of excellence within the Indian cricket team. His successes have reset standards for contemporary pace bowlers, proving that precision and strategy carry the same weight as sheer velocity in Test cricket success.

Shami’s Reliable Performance

Mohammed Shami embodies reliability and longevity in India’s fast bowling unit, producing steady results across numerous international campaigns. His skill at moving the ball through the air in both new-ball and middle-overs phases makes him exceptionally versatile. Shami’s familiarity with varying match conditions has proven invaluable in important Test matches. His work ethic and professionalism have made him a cornerstone of India’s pace attack. In spite of battling injuries during his playing years, Shami has demonstrated remarkable resilience, returning stronger and more determined each time.

Shami’s recent performances have strengthened his status as a game-changer capable of delivering under pressure. His bowling blends pace with movement, creating constant challenges for opposing batsmen. In latest global tournaments, Shami has showcased enhanced physical conditioning and renewed vigor, contributing significantly in India’s Test victories. His understanding of game situations and tactical acumen strengthen India’s overall bowling approach. Shami’s consistency provides stability to the fast bowling unit, allowing younger bowlers to build self-assurance and perform meaningfully to team success.

Tactical Strategies and Performance Outcomes

India’s quick bowlers have reshaped their game plan in Test cricket, employing planned variations that capitalize on pitch conditions and batsman weaknesses. The team utilizes aggressive short-pitched bowling combined with yorkers and slower deliveries to destabilize batsmen. Captains have introduced rotating strategies that optimize bowler performance while controlling workload in extended series. This multifaceted approach has proven especially successful in home conditions, where spinners work alongside quick bowling seamlessly. The teamwork of quick bowlers creates sustained pressure, pushing opposition batsmen into cautious batting and securing important breakthroughs at crucial stages.

Recent performances demonstrate the success of India’s bowling approaches across various international venues. Against traditional powerhouses, Indian fast bowlers have consistently delivered match-decisive displays, claiming crucial wickets during key junctures. Their ability to adapt to varying pitch conditions—from seaming pitches in England to lively pitches in Australia—showcases tactical flexibility and technical improvement. Data examination shows better control figures and strike rates versus earlier eras, suggesting enhanced precision and aggression. These performances have positioned India as genuine Test cricket contenders, able to perform successfully against all opposition regardless of venue or circumstances.
